What Are the Best Ways to Protect My Privacy?

Privacy is not a binary "yes or no" but a spectrum of risk management. The most effective tool is the creation of a strict stage persona—a different name, a different style, and a curated set of personal details that are entirely fictional. Using geo-blocking features available in live streaming tools allows you to hide your broadcasts from your home state or country, significantly reducing the chance of "real-life" discovery.
